Directions (31-35) : In these questions, relationship between different elements is shonn in the statements. The statements is followed by conclusions. Study the conclusions based on the given statement and
Give answer :
(1) If only conclusion I is true
(2) If only conclusion II is true.
(3) If either conclusion I or II is true
(4) If neither conclusion I nor II is true
(5) If both conclusions I and II are true
Statements : P \( \large \ge \) A > C = E; K \( \large \le \) C < U
Conclusions : I. E < U II. P > K

Description for Correct answer:
P \( \large \ge \) A > C = E
K \( \large \le \) C < U
E = C < U
P \( \large \ge \) A > C \( \large \ge \) K
Conclusions : I. E < U --> True
II. P > K --> True
